Okay, now I need to pull out a few of my old mixed tapes! Today’s society member spotlight is shining on Canadian artist Mandy van Leeuwen. She paints on everything from canvas to walls, both inside and outside! Here’s a little snippet from Mandy’s website:
Approaching her paintings with ‘magical realism’, she finds inspiration in the positive transformation of forgotten spaces and objects. Whether depicting old trailers, still life arrangements, or surreal landscapes, her paintings inspire us with a renewed sense of beauty.
Magic and beauty… great combo. Follow Mandy on Instagram at @mandy_vanleeuwen, and find her available paintings at Woodlands Gallery. *Bio photo by @rejeanbrandt.
